When you retire, you may be able to elect any of several SBP options, which are listed below. SBP elections cannot be canceled or changed after retirement except in specific instances such as a change in your marital status or after the loss of a beneficiary. WebFeb 23, 2024 · AR Pistol vs. SBR: Size Matters. Before we can address the pros and cons of a Short Barreled Rifle (SBR), first we have to define one. An SBR is a rifle with a barrel less than 16 inches or a rifle with a barrel of 16 inches or longer but an overall length of fewer than 26 inches. WebJan 20, 2024 · It would be a matter of determining if paying $300 a month for life would be worth the potential for receiving $1,500 a month for life. Example: Fred and Wilma are married and Fred is retiring. He elects the 10% survivor benefit and has $300 deducted from his check each month so that when he dies, Wilma can receive $1,500.
